This set of books has these stories :The riveting tale of a nations rise from poverty to prosperity, and the clash of ideas that occurred along the way, The story of an ancient civilizations reawakening to the spirit-and potential-of its youth. , A superb exposition of the dilemmas and ambiguities inherent in the Mahabharata that shows us how we can come to terms with the uncertain ethics of our times.What India needs is a strong, liberal state, but achieving this will not be easy, because India has historically had a weak state and a strong society.
